Heard the learned counsel for petitioner and the learned Government Pleader for Respondents and perused the material available on record.

2.

Petitioner claims to be owner of land to an extent of Ac.0-311⁄2 guntas in Survey No.571/A of Kanna village, Palakurthy mandal, Peddapally district. He entered into an agreement of sale to sell the property and having received sale consideration, deed of sale was drawn and when it was sought to be presented before the Registration authorities, the same was refused. To show bonafides, petitioner filed challan before this Court, upon which stamp duty was paid.

3. In view of the same, the 2nd respondent is directed to receive the sale deed presented by the petitioner in respect of the subject property and process the same. If the document is not registerable, the 2nd respondent shall assign due reasons in support of his decision and communicate to the same to the petitioner. If there is no embargo to register the document, the subject document shall be registered forthwith.

4.

With the above direction, the writ petition is disposed of. As a sequel, the miscellaneous applications, if any, shall stand closed. There shall be no order as to costs.
